Angular is the framework of choice for teams building large-scale, long-lived frontend applications where architectural consistency and maintainability matter. Its opinionated structure, built-in tooling, and TypeScript foundation reduce the decision fatigue that comes with more flexible alternatives. For enterprise teams managing complex codebases across multiple developers, Angular's conventions are a feature, not a constraint.
Angular is used to build enterprise single-page applications, complex dashboards and data visualization interfaces, multi-step form systems, component libraries shared across product teams, and large-scale customer portals. It's the natural choice when the frontend application is complex enough to benefit from Angular's strong opinions on structure, dependency injection, and module organization.
Angular is widely used by enterprise engineering teams at companies in finance, healthcare, logistics, government, and SaaS who need a frontend framework that scales with team size and codebase complexity. Google, Microsoft, and hundreds of Fortune 500 companies run Angular in production. It's particularly common in organizations that have already standardized on TypeScript and need a framework that enforces consistent patterns across large development teams.
Angular's architecture enforces separation of concerns through modules, components, services, and dependency injection — making large codebases significantly easier to navigate, test, and maintain. Its built-in support for lazy loading, change detection control, and SSR via Angular Universal gives teams the performance levers needed for enterprise-scale applications. The opinionated structure also means new engineers can onboard faster, because the patterns are consistent across the entire codebase.
Angular CLI, Nx workspace tooling, a rich ecosystem of pre-built component libraries, and strong IDE support in VS Code and WebStorm allow engineers to move from architecture to working features quickly. Built-in solutions for routing, forms, HTTP, and testing mean teams spend less time wiring up infrastructure and more time building product. For enterprise teams with clear requirements, Angular's conventions accelerate delivery without accumulating frontend debt.

An Angular engineer designs, builds, and maintains frontend applications using Angular and TypeScript — handling component architecture, state management, API integration, testing, and performance optimization. Senior engineers also lead migrations and establish coding standards across teams.
Angular's opinionated structure enforces consistency across large teams, reduces architectural drift, and provides built-in solutions for routing, forms, HTTP, and testing. For complex, long-lived applications, its conventions pay dividends as the codebase and team size grow.

Modern Angular with OnPush change detection, lazy-loaded modules, esbuild-optimized bundles, and SSR via Angular Universal delivers excellent performance at scale. With the right architecture in place, Angular handles complex UIs and high data volumes without meaningful degradation.
With Angular you can build enterprise SPAs, dashboards, component libraries, customer portals, real-time data interfaces, micro-frontend platforms, and progressive web apps. It covers the full breadth of modern enterprise frontend requirements.
